Context
Abu Huraira narrates a warning from the Prophet Muhammad ﷺ about impending turmoil, where the one who sits will be better than the one who stands, and so forth. This hierarchy of action during times of chaos suggests that in moments of instability, it is better to remain passive and seek refuge than to engage actively. The hadith serves as a cautionary reminder of the challenges that may arise.
Modern Application
In today's world, this hadith can be applied to situations of conflict or uncertainty, encouraging individuals to assess their involvement carefully. It highlights the importance of seeking safety and making wise choices during turbulent times, rather than rushing into potentially harmful situations.
